With the continuous development of measuring technology, it's higher and higher that the requirements of accuracy and rapidity in modern industry to objects'dimensional detection. As a non-contact measuring tool, image measuring art has many merits such as high-accuracy, high-speed, high-efficiency and high automatic degree. Therefore it satisfies the demands of the industrial testing field very well and applies widely in producting and processing. From the start of measuring question of axisymmetric objects'geometrical dimensions, the paper is committed to building the image measuring system which is suitable for engineering application.Firstly, it describes the relevant theories of the image measuring technique, and explains its current situation and developing trend. According to the the testing requirements of actual engineering, it is designed that the cylinders'dimensional measuring system including hardware and software systems based on the measuring principles of cylinders'parameters. And it raises the measuring programs of cylinders'height, top diameters and roundness error, diameters and thickness of the base.Secondly, it analyzes the components of hardware system, which is composed of the illuminational systems and the systems of image sensors. And it discusses the selections of every part in hardware systems.Furthermore, according to requirements of the project, the paper studies the camera calibration and image processing algorithms of software system. On the basis of Tsai calibration, it puts forward a kind of method for planar calibrating, which is joined the calibrations of principal point coordinate and aspect ratio. In addition, it is introduced that the intermediate variable, which greatly reduces the computational complexity and improves running-speed on the analysis of least square method for roundness error assessing.Finally, we take cylinders of three models as detecting objects, and use the measuring system to measure their geometric dimensions actually, then complete the detectional experiments of parameters, also carry out analyses on measuring errors. The experimental results show that the system can meet the requirements of accuracy, so it can be used for engineering testing.
